Northern Horizon Capital's Commitment to Enhanced Governance
Northern Horizon Capital AS, known for its commitment to good governance, has been under the scrutiny of the Estonian Financial Supervision and Resolution Authority (FSA). This attention followed an on-site inspection conducted in May 2024, aimed at evaluating the company's internal control systems and the effectiveness of measures meant to prevent conflicts of interest.
FSA's Findings and Northern Horizon's Response
On December 19, 2024, the FSA issued a precept to Northern Horizon Capital AS requiring improvements in specific aspects of its internal control processes. This directive was a significant step in addressing some identified weaknesses within the company. The FSA's role is crucial, as their inspections ensure that financial institutions uphold high standards of operation and governance.
In response to the findings, Northern Horizon Capital AS has demonstrated remarkable cooperation with the FSA. They were proactive in addressing the issues raised, preparing an action plan by August 2024. Many weaknesses have already been remedied, showing the company's dedication to elevating its operational standards.
Lars Ohnemus on Governance Practices
Lars Ohnemus, the Chairman of the Supervisory Council of Northern Horizon Capital AS, expressed the company’s commitment to maintaining exemplary governance practices. He acknowledged the importance of addressing the points raised in the FSA report promptly. According to him, “Our commitment to good governance practices is fundamental. It has been essential for us to make adjustments as swiftly as possible. The majority of points raised in the report have already been addressed, and we continue our efforts.”
Understanding the Role of Northern Horizon Capital AS
Northern Horizon Capital AS is a prominent player in the real estate sector and operates under the Alternative Investment Fund Manager (AIFM) license. The firm is dedicated to managing assets responsibly while 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ements. Those interested in real estate investments can look to the Baltic Horizon Fund, for which Northern Horizon Capital AS serves as a manager.
How the Fund Operates
The Baltic Horizon Fund, managed by Northern Horizon Capital AS, operates as a registered contractual public closed-end real estate fund. This structure allows for a focused investment strategy while aiming to deliver stable returns to investors.
